Located 15 minutes from Plymouth this wonderful attraction is home to over 150 animals. Dartmoor Zoo was made famous by the feature film, “We Bought a Zoo” and has since gone from strength to strength, It is now an entirely unique environment, a wonderful family day out, and an award-winning conservation park.


Dartmoor Zoological Park partnered with our team to create an immersive 360° virtual tour aimed at showcasing their expansive park, the freedom of the animal enclosures, and the unique visitor experience. Located near Plymouth and home to over 150 animals, the zoo needed a digital asset to increase engagement, support bookings, and reflect their conservation credentials. The result is a high-quality, interactive tour that features hotspots, social-media-ready imagery and VR compatibility.
